Operations & People Manager
Employer: National Numeracy
Location: Remote / hybrid /office working flexibility (Head Office in East Sussex) We welcome applications from across the UK but a candidate able to easily travel, by rail, would be advantageous. Our team are spread across the UK and are predominantly remote-working, but we do have hybrid and office-based members. Opportunities to meet in person do occur, and we run at least two whole organisation team away days per year.
Temporary: Contract or temporary (Fixed Term Maternity Cover to end 31st July 2027)
Working hours: Full-time or part-time (30 or 37hrs 30 per week)
Salary: £42,735 per year
Closing date: 10pm Wednesday 17 June 2026

This is a pivotal role at National Numeracy, helping to ensure our people, systems and processes enable the
successful delivery of our mission to improve numeracy across the UK.
As a key member of the operations function, you will work closely with the Operations & Impact Director to
strengthen organisational effectiveness, support colleagues across the organisation and help drive
continuous improvement in the way we work.
During this maternity cover period, a particular focus will be supporting the ongoing development and
adoption of our CRM and operational systems, ensuring they provide robust information, efficient processes
and an excellent user experience. You will also play a central role in maintaining effective governance,
supporting our people practices and helping to foster a positive, inclusive and high-performing organisational
culture.
This role is ideal for someone who enjoys improving systems, enabling others to do their best work and
helping mission-driven organisations operate effectively and sustainably.
The postholder will also provide line management and support to one team member, helping to ensure their
development, wellbeing and contribution to organisational objectives.
The role is a maternity leave cover with an ideal start date in August 2026 and an anticipated end date of
31st July 2027. It would be suitable for either 4 or 5 days per week.
